We are living through times of rapid change. New technology has affected almost every area of our lives — so why should the way we do business stay the same?

Can new technology take the guesswork out of knowing what your customer really wants? What can neuroscience teach us about how consumers make decisions? And what does the ‘age of the customer’ really mean for your business?
